Understanding Local Care Costs
Costs in this region are directly influenced by the personalized level of care provided. Prairie Pines Assisted Living Community offers specialized care starting at $5,500 per month, reflecting the localized support services and staff attention provided in the building.
Understanding that these figures represent a base rate for customized service is useful when planning. The monthly expense supports both accommodation and necessary daily assistance, tailored for the local setting.
